6 tablespoons flour, divided
1 1/2 pounds chuck roast
3 cups cola
1 cup frozen seasoning blend (contains onions, green peppers, celery)
1 cup baby carrots
1 (14 1/2-ounce) jar beef gravy
1 (10-ounce) box frozen green peas
2 teaspoons Montreal steak seasoning
1/4 cup water
Steps
1. Preheat slow cooker on high. Dredge roast in 1/4 cup flour to coat both sides; place in slow cooker. Wash hands. Stir in remaining ingredients except flour and water. Reduce heat to low; cook 8–10 hours.
2. 30 minutes before serving, increase heat to high. Break roast apart, using 2 forks. Combine in small bowl, remaining 2 tablespoons flour with water until smooth. Add to roast while stirring continuously. Cook 30 more minutes. Serve.
